Recent Changes to Google’s Product Taxonomy

In early May Google made some adjustments to their product taxonomy. Customers using the ‘Others’ category or a category not specific to their products will now need to specify the specific ‘Category Taxonomy’ of their products.

How does one do this?

Step 1: Activating Google taxonomy

1. Go to your store admin panel

2. System>Configurations>Sales>Google API>Google Shopping

3. Once here, you should see an option called “Google Product Taxonomy”. Click the “Update Google Taxonomy” button

4. You will get a new list, select the category that most closely resembles your products and hit “Update Google Taxonomy” button, then do “Save Config”

Step 2: Apply taxonomy to attributes

1. Go to Catalog > Google Content> Manage Attributes

2. Select the Attribute set that has been mapped or “Add new”

3. Under Google Product Category, hit “Select Category”

4. Then select down to the exact product category you will be uploading to Google and press “Select Category”

5. Save Mapping

This should send the exact product category type to Google so that your products are validated!
